$5 Thrift Store Dresser

So Goodwill wanted to get rid of this dresser.  The top was warped and the drawers wouldn't shut right.  I said I'd take it for $5 and they said yes.  
I replaced the top with 3 6" x 1" pieces of plywood.  Painted the dresser two shades of gray.  Replaced the knobs with round discs and added 1 1/2" lucite starfish pieces and lined the shelves with black and white contact paper and voila.

So I planted my usual tomatoes this year.  I planted the cherry tomatoes in an Earthbox and then the full size tomatoes is a regular pot.  Again, this year the cherry tomatoes developed blossom end rot.  I lost the first 8-10 tomatoes.  I googled it to see what I needed to do.  After the first several articles I was pretty convinced my tomatoes weren't getting enough calcium.  The articles suggested things/chemicals to buy to solve the problem but I was too lazy to go out and buy something so I smashed up two of my calcium vitamins and dropped them down the watering shoot and in two days I was picking perfect tasty tomatoes.  Problem solved!
